On Comparing the Development Procedures of Native Language Acquisition and Foreign Language Learning
Li Li
Abstract
Li Li
Abstract
This paper tries to interpret the development and features of children′s native language acquisition from the angle of native language acquisition and its development.The differences between the native language acquisition and foreign language learning are then compared from some aspects such as: age,cognitive ability,psychological factor,social factor and mother-tongue interference.And finally the paper discusses the implication of native language acquisition for TEFL.
